I just got done with my first "swing" at applying to a ANG F-16 unit. Made the interview, but didnt get the slot. Totally different experience from what I dealt with in ROTC. ANG units want to know you as a person whereas ROTC was all about numbers and scores.

This was an awesome experience. Although I only applied to one unit, I feel like I can give some advice to anyone wanting to know more about this process. Personally I think going after an UPT slot with an ANG unit is the best way to get a "insert a/c here" slot. You can't slack off at UPT, but if you make the grade you KNOW what you will be flying when you are done. Can't beat that!

I am trying to get a UPT slot at my Guard unit(F-16CJs) and from what I know you cannot slack off. All the young guys that are at my unit tell me that you have to finish in the fighter track group. If you don't your flight CC(or guy in charge of the board) will ask for an honest opinion of your performance at UPT(wanting to know if you have what it takes to be a fighter pilot) and if you don't... your toaste(you go to a heavy unit). This has happened to 3 out of 6 guys that we have sent more recently. They went to a C-130 and C-17 base. Anyway... thats how it is at our unit... If anyone has any advice for me let me know...
